Output 9209639b3cae31023a2d4c6291e919ea39f44b350abfd4ddfc3b8f853939781a:0

value
53102187
script pubkey
OP_0 OP_PUSHBYTES_20 70b4acf95e6bacbfbed2ddac05536bbd0bd5eef2
address
bc1qwz62e727dwktl0kjmkkq25mth59atmhj69satq
transaction
9209639b3cae31023a2d4c6291e919ea39f44b350abfd4ddfc3b8f853939781a
spent
true